Traditionally, sending money from Japan to China involved wire transfers through major Japanese banks like Japan Post Bank (ゆうちょ銀行), MUFG, SMBC, and Mizuho. While secure, these transfers often come with substantial fees, including lifting charges (送金手数料) that can quickly add up. These fees can range from several thousand yen depending on the amount sent and the receiving bank. Digital remittance apps, however, are increasingly popular as money transfer providers with low fees from Japan to China offer more competitive rates.
A key factor to consider is the FX margin (spread) – the difference between the exchange rate offered by the service and the mid-market rate. Traditional banks often have less transparent FX margins, effectively hiding additional costs. Transfer speed depends on several factors, including the Know Your Customer (KYC) verification process, bank processing hours in Japan, and the clearing times of Chinese banks. Instant or fast JPY to CNY transfer services leverage technology to streamline these processes. KYC verification, while essential for regulatory compliance, can sometimes cause delays. Japanese banks typically process international transfers during business hours, while Chinese banks have their own clearing schedules.

Security is paramount when sending money internationally. Reputable remittance services employ robust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ML) procedures to prevent fraud and comply with regulations. This includes verifying the identity of senders and recipients, and monitoring transactions for suspicious activity. Data encryption is used to protect sensitive information during transmission and storage. Traceability is also crucial, allowing for the tracking of funds and investigation of any issues that may arise.
